The trunnion mounted ball valve is especially crucial in high-volume and high-pressure systems. Unlike drifting ball valves, the ball in a trunnion mounted valve is sustained at the top and bottom, providing minimized valve torque and raised functional performance. This layout is very preferred in the oil and gas industry where valve performance under high pressure is crucial. Similarly, the metal seated ball valve is engineered for extreme conditions. Unlike softer products, metal seats can hold up against high temperature levels, unpleasant liquids, and harsh settings. This makes metal seated ball valves the best option for many tough applications throughout numerous markets.

Butterfly valves are another essential group of valves, with the triple offset butterfly valve and the double offset butterfly valve being significant for their unique layouts. The triple offset butterfly valve features 3 separate offsets that function with each other to minimize wear and expand the valve's life expectancy, making it ideal for high-temperature applications.
